Construction on the trail began in 1915 – a year after Muir’s death ...Due to extremely high demand, many John Muir Trail thru-hike permit applications are denied. For a typical summer day, the park receives at least 300 to 500 reservation requests. Of those requests, approximately 80% to 90% are for the John Muir Trail while the other 10% to 20% are for all other routes in the park. Whitney, but face a challenging 2% success rate given the volume of applicants. These permits have been regulated by the same quota system for over 25 years ...When Is A Wilderness Permit Required? Wilderness permits are required on the Sierra National Forest for all overnight trips into the John Muir, Ansel Adams, Dinkey and Kaiser Wildernesses. Trailhead quotas (For Quota and Trail Information) are in place year round. A wilderness permit is not required for day hikes into the wilderness areas.Oct 29, 2023 · 36 miles. A wilderness permit is required for each party staying overnight in the wilderness. Beginning in 2022, reservations are handled by Recreation.gov. Reservations by a weekly lottery for 60% of available permits for hikes beginning in Yosemite can be made up to 24 weeks in advance of departure date. A Expert Advice On Improvin...By now it’s probably evident that acquiring permits to do the John Muir Trail is difficult. The southbound permit is one of the most competitive hiking permits in U.S., along with The Wave in Arizona and the Core Zone of the Enchantments in Washington.
